The research behind writing and wellbeing
Research shows that structured writing can support wellbeing when used in a careful and guided way.
Studies suggest that reflective writing may help people:
organise their thoughts
manage stress
improve emotional awareness
feel calmer and more regulated
Writing gives us time to pause and think.
Putting thoughts on paper can make them easier to understand, reflect and then manage.

Heal From Within Through Writing
Writing uses more than one part of the brain at the same time. This can help us slow down, notice patterns, and reflect more deeply than we might through talking alone. When thoughts are written down: they often feel less overwhelming people can see things more clearly emotions become easier to recognise and name This process supports reflection and personal insight. It does not replace therapy or clinical care.
